CustomizeGoogle是一款专为Firefox浏览器设计的插件,它通过引入附加信息来增强Google搜索结果的实用性。此插件不仅能连接到Baidu、Yahoo、MSN等其他搜索引擎,为用户提供更丰富的搜索选项,还能有效去除搜索结果中的广告和其他非必要信息,从而提升用户的搜索体验。
CustomizeGoogle, Firefox插件, 搜索优化, 去广告, 代码示例
CustomizeGoogle 插件以其独特的优势和功能,在众多浏览器插件中脱颖而出。该插件的核心目标是通过增加额外的信息来优化 Google 的搜索结果页面,使用户能够获得更加丰富且实用的搜索体验。以下是该插件的一些主要功能和特点:
下面是一个简单的代码示例,展示了如何使用 CustomizeGoogle 移除 Google 搜索结果页面上的广告:
// 代码示例:移除 Google 搜索结果页面上的广告
function removeAds() {
var ads = document.querySelectorAll('.adsbygoogle');
for (var i = 0; i < ads.length; i++) {
ads[i].parentNode.removeChild(ads[i]);
}
}
removeAds();
通过上述代码,用户可以轻松地从搜索结果页面上去除广告,享受更加纯净的浏览体验。
尽管 CustomizeGoogle 插件可以在多种浏览器上运行,但选择 Firefox 作为其主要开发平台的原因有几点:
总之,CustomizeGoogle 选择 Firefox 作为主要平台,不仅是因为 Firefox 提供了强大的技术支持,还因为它能够满足用户对于隐私保护和个性化需求的高度关注。
假设用户希望在搜索过程中排除所有广告信息,只需简单几步即可实现:
下面是一个具体的代码示例,展示了如何通过 CustomizeGoogle 实现这一功能:
// 代码示例:使用 CustomizeGoogle 移除 Google 搜索结果页面上的广告
function removeAds() {
var ads = document.querySelectorAll('.adsbygoogle');
for (var i = 0; i < ads.length; i++) {
ads[i].parentNode.removeChild(ads[i]);
}
}
// 自动执行函数
removeAds();
通过这段代码,用户可以轻松地从搜索结果页面上去除广告,享受更加纯净的浏览体验。
CustomizeGoogle 的广告去除功能主要基于对网页 DOM(文档对象模型)的操作。当用户使用 Google 进行搜索时,插件会监听页面加载事件,并在页面完全加载后执行相应的脚本,查找并移除包含广告信息的 HTML 元素。
具体步骤如下:
DOMContentLoaded
事件,确保在页面加载完毕后执行后续操作。querySelectorAll
方法定位页面中带有特定类名(如 .adsbygoogle
)的元素。removeChild
方法将其从 DOM 树中移除。在实际应用中,使用 CustomizeGoogle 插件后,用户可以明显感受到搜索结果页面的变化。原本占据显眼位置的广告信息被彻底清除,取而代之的是更加整洁、聚焦于内容本身的页面布局。这种改变不仅提升了用户体验,也使得搜索过程变得更加高效和直接。
此外,由于插件还支持连接到其他搜索引擎,用户还可以根据需要切换至 Baidu、Yahoo 或 MSN 等平台进行搜索,进一步拓展了信息获取的渠道。
安装 CustomizeGoogle 插件的过程十分简便,只需遵循以下几个简单的步骤即可完成:
完成以上步骤后,CustomizeGoogle 插件便已成功安装在您的 Firefox 浏览器中,您可以立即开始使用它来优化您的搜索体验。
CustomizeGoogle 插件提供了丰富的个性化配置选项,以满足不同用户的需求。下面是一些常见的配置步骤:
通过这些个性化配置,用户可以根据自己的需求和偏好来定制搜索体验,从而获得更加高效、便捷的搜索结果。无论是在日常生活中还是工作中,CustomizeGoogle 都能成为您搜索信息的强大助手。
// 代码示例:移除 Google 搜索结果页面上的广告
function removeAds() {
var ads = document.querySelectorAll('.adsbygoogle');
for (var i = 0; i < ads.length; i++) {
ads[i].parentNode.removeChild(ads[i]);
}
}
removeAds();
解析:
removeAds()
函数用于移除页面上的广告元素。document.querySelectorAll('.adsbygoogle')
方法选取页面上所有带有 .adsbygoogle
类名的元素,这些元素通常是 Google 搜索结果页面上的广告。for
循环遍历选取的所有广告元素,并使用 removeChild
方法将它们从 DOM 树中移除,从而实现广告的去除。// 代码示例:使用 CustomizeGoogle 移除 Google 搜索结果页面上的广告
function removeAds() {
var ads = document.querySelectorAll('.adsbygoogle');
for (var i = 0; i < ads.length; i++) {
ads[i].parentNode.removeChild(ads[i]);
}
}
// 自动执行函数
removeAds();
解析:
removeAds()
函数,确保每次页面加载时都会自动执行广告去除功能。通过上述操作指南和技巧分享,用户可以充分利用 CustomizeGoogle 插件的各项功能,优化搜索体验,提高工作效率。
CustomizeGoogle 插件通过一系列先进的算法和技术手段,能够有效地优化 Google 搜索结果页面。它不仅能够去除令人烦恼的广告信息,还能屏蔽其他无关紧要的内容,如重复链接、低质量网站等,从而确保用户能够快速找到有价值的信息。这种优化功能极大地提升了用户的搜索效率和满意度。
除了 Google 之外,CustomizeGoogle 还支持连接到其他主流搜索引擎,如 Baidu、Yahoo 和 MSN 等。这种多引擎集成的设计为用户提供了极大的灵活性,可以根据不同的搜索需求选择最适合的搜索引擎。例如,在寻找中文资源时,用户可能会倾向于使用 Baidu;而在寻求国际化的信息时,则可能会选择 Yahoo 或 MSN。这种多样化的选择使得用户能够获得更广泛、更全面的信息来源。
CustomizeGoogle 插件提供了丰富的个性化设置选项,允许用户根据自己的喜好和需求定制搜索体验。用户不仅可以选择隐藏特定类型的链接,还可以调整搜索结果的排序方式,甚至更改页面布局。这种高度的可定制性使得每个用户都能够拥有独一无二的搜索体验,满足了不同用户群体的需求。
为了帮助用户更好地理解和使用该插件,开发者提供了详细的代码示例和文档。这些示例不仅包括了如何安装和配置插件的基本步骤,还包括了如何利用插件的各种高级功能。此外,CustomizeGoogle 的开发者社区也非常活跃,用户可以在这里获得及时的技术支持和反馈,有助于解决使用过程中遇到的问题。
尽管 CustomizeGoogle 主要在 Firefox 浏览器上运行良好,但在其他浏览器上的兼容性可能存在一定的限制。这意味着如果用户使用的是 Chrome、Safari 或 Edge 等其他浏览器,可能无法享受到该插件提供的全部功能。因此,在选择使用 CustomizeGoogle 之前,用户需要确保自己正在使用 Firefox 浏览器。
由于互联网环境和技术的不断变化,搜索引擎的算法也会随之更新。为了保持插件的有效性,开发者需要定期更新插件以适应这些变化。然而,如果更新频率不够高,可能会导致某些新出现的广告类型或搜索结果布局无法被正确处理,从而影响用户体验。
虽然 Firefox 浏览器在隐私保护方面表现优秀,但插件本身也可能存在一定的隐私风险。例如,如果插件收集了过多的用户数据,可能会引发隐私泄露的问题。因此,用户在使用 CustomizeGoogle 时需要注意检查其隐私政策,确保自己的个人信息得到妥善保护。
综上所述,尽管 CustomizeGoogle 插件在搜索优化方面表现出色,但也存在一些潜在的局限性。用户在使用时应充分考虑这些因素,以确保获得最佳的使用体验。
通过本文的介绍,我们深入了解了CustomizeGoogle这款专为Firefox浏览器设计的插件。它不仅能够显著提升Google搜索结果的实用性,还能有效去除广告和其他非必要信息,为用户提供更加纯净的搜索体验。借助其多引擎集成的特点,用户可以轻松切换至Baidu、Yahoo、MSN等搜索引擎,获取更全面的信息。此外,丰富的个性化设置选项让每位用户都能根据自己的需求定制搜索体验。尽管CustomizeGoogle在搜索优化方面表现出色,但仍需注意其在兼容性、更新频率及用户隐私保护方面的潜在局限性。总体而言,CustomizeGoogle是一款值得推荐的工具,能够显著提升用户的在线搜索效率和满意度。